Raptors earn first win of season

CASPER, Wyo. -- Blake Bolles threw four touchdown passes, and ran for four more touchdowns as the Everett Raptors earned their first win of the season by defeating the Wyoming Cavalry 68-50 on Sunday in an Indoor Football League game.

Bolles completed 18-of-27 passes for 233 yards, and Andre Piper-Jordan caught five passes for 86 yards and two touchdowns for Everett (1-2).

Matt Strand threw six touchdown passes, three to Jasonus Tillery, for Wyoming (0-2).
